The main pathophysiological mechanism of HE are based upon evidence of the accumulation of toxic substances, including the ammonia, glutamine, manganese, false neurotransmitters, inflammation, short chain fatty acids, oxidative stress, mercaptanes, neurosteroids, or low grade edema.2 However, the most widely accepted is that accumulation of endogenous and gut-derived ammonia crossing the blood-brain barrier, and functional changes in various neurotransmitter systems.3 Thus, current therapies focus on pathogenesis previously accepted, and the roles of drugs were critically estimated through systematic review according to methodology of Evidence-based Medicine (EBM), such as non-absorbable disaccharides,4 rifaximin,5 L-ornithine-L-aspartate (LOLA),6 naloxone7 have been widespread used now
